Insurance Authorization Coordinator

Posted Aug 8

This is a fully remote position, open to applicants in Florida.

📋 Description

• Secure preauthorization for designated specialties and manage various workflow tasks.

• Submit necessary documentation and follow up to guarantee prompt authorization approvals.

• Process authorization and notification requests in line with departmental policies and payer requirements.

• Verify insurance coverage, eligibility, demographics, benefits, and patient financial responsibilities.

• Identify prior authorization and predetermination criteria for medical procedures and treatments.

• Stay informed about insurance policies, guidelines, procedures, and medical coverage standards.

• Manage appointment additions, schedule modifications, date alterations, and significant service changes.

• Follow administrative review protocols for services that lack authorization beyond standard timelines.

• Communicate updates regarding authorizations and address inquiries from patients, families, and healthcare professionals.

• Review clinical documentation for necessary information required in payer submissions.

• Maintain precise records of requests, approvals, denials, correspondence, patient details, insurance information, and authorization activities.

• Collaborate with healthcare providers, physicians, clinical staff, Central Business Office, Financial Services, Transport, Patient Cost Estimation, Managed Care, Utilization Review, Authorization Departments, and other relevant teams.

• Address authorization obstacles, denials, and appeals while identifying alternative solutions.

• Participate in daily departmental meetings and report payer concerns, workflow challenges, and risks of non-reimbursable or canceled services.

• Comply with all relevant laws, regulations, privacy standards, and organizational policies.

• Perform additional responsibilities as assigned.


⛳️ Requirements

• High School Diploma is mandatory.

• Six months to two years of experience in authorization is essential.

• Familiarity with insurance plans and third-party payer requirements is required.

• Understanding of CPT and ICD-10 codes alongside basic medical terminology is needed.

• Knowledge of role-specific Epic Applications is necessary.

• Proficiency in Microsoft Word, Excel, and Outlook is required.

• Capability to work efficiently in a virtual team environment.

• Ability to identify and resolve authorization challenges, denials, and appeals is necessary.

• Must maintain accurate authorization and insurance records.

• Compliance with laws, regulations, privacy standards, and organizational policies is essential.
